Title :
Traffic Modeling for Massive Multiplayer On-line Role Playing Game (MMORPG) in GPRS Access Network
Author :
Wu, Yi ; Huang, Hui ; Zhang, Dongmei
Author_Institution :
Nokia Res. Center, Beijing
Abstract :
Investigation of the multiplayer on-line game traffic is not only interesting but also important. From network point of view, accurate traffic models are highly required to generate a characteristic load for analysis or simulation approach. In this paper we focus on source modeling of the massive multiplayer on-line role playing game (MMORPG) traffic in mobile networks. Our results show that because of the extremely large number of the on-line players and special communication requirement of the role playing game style, the server-generated traffic of the MMORPG becomes much complicated and has a tight relationship with specific game design
